This is the latest version of Reebok’s plant-based highperformance running shoe.
Conscious of the impact of unsustainable waste materials on the environment, this brand has made an effort to source and design more sustainable products for our future, evident in the natural materials it uses, such as castor beans, eucalyptus, algae bloom and natural rubber, without forsaking the high-performance standards of best-in-class running shoes. In fact,
Reebok guarantees at least 50% of the materials it uses are plant-based.
There are two pillars under which the brand focuses its sustainability efforts: (REE)GROW to create products from natural materials and (Ree)cycled to create products from recycled or repurposed materials.
By 2024, Reebok plans to eliminate virgin polyester from its material mix.
Joel Charley, chief operating officer of Midnight Runners UK, says, ‘As far as I can tell there’s no sacrifice in performance and certainly not in style. This no-compromise, sustainable approach is wonderful to experience as Reebok takes steps (no pun intended) towards doing their part for the future of our planet.’
